Hello Sushi Squad,

As we are going through this copyright takedown fiasco, we've decided to pause uploads for the next couple of days as we figure out how we should move forward in terms of editing our reactions to comply with the copyright laws. We are figuring out what is the best way to share our reactions on both Youtube and Patreon. Please continue to share ideas! We have heard of timed reactions (not ideal), also links hosted on different platforms such as discord/streamable etc. We are open to anything. Really we will see how others are doing it and make sure we give the best experience to you all.

We haven't finalized any decisions yet, as we are still brainstorming and talking with other creators about how they are handling this, but we will of course update y'all.

For now, we've released the last 2 Season 5 MHA episodes and the final Season 1 OPM episode (on our website) since we will be having the end of season livestream for both shows tonight! But there will be no other uploads for the next couple of days.

Thank you guys for being patient with us and sending us so much positive energy and love during this scary time. We appreciate y'all so much <3

Other creators that I follow have no problem with the copyright (MHA). They put the video on Vimeo with a password. When they post the new post on Patreon, they give the link of the video and the password. No problem at all. Timed reactions is the worst case for most of the people. For Timed reactions, we can only watch the video on PC because we need to launch 2 videos in the same time. It's not possible on phone and tablet. I love your reaction but if it become a timed reaction, I will unsubscribe because I watch your reaction on tablet or phone.

May be worth looking into how Neel Desai runs things. He does a great job with those, but I will say that pulling up a bunch of windows for run time stuff is never fun, and I even have three monitors so not sure how people feel with one or if they watch you guys through an app. If you do end up doing run timers, I will say that I have seen other content creators allow a picture in picture mode for their patreon reactions where you can enable it and patrons simply set the square overlay wherever they want on their screen as an overlay while you watch along. With that, people with one monitor (or even multiple) could dedicate the same screen to both the episode and the reaction. I'd highly recommend just looking at all the options available.
